Overview of the Diet

Basically this is a book and a diet that was written and developed by Suzanne Somers and it is developed around the premise that you can actually eat anything and lose the weight you want to. However, it does stress that you have to eat in certain combinations if you want to lose weight. The author points out that she thinks that it is certain combinations of food that make people fat, so she shows how to combine foods in certain ways that are to help you lose weight.

Foods You Can Eat and Some You Can’t

When it comes to eating foods on Suzanne Somers dieting plan, you can just about eat anything; however, it is how you eat it that is so important to this diet. When you eat fruits, you are only supposed to eat them by themselves. Proteins and fats are supposed to be eaten with vegetables and when you eat carbs, you’re allowed to eat them with vegetables, but not with fats. Fats and proteins are never to be eaten along with carbs. Also, if you want to change the type of meal you’re eating, you have to wait at least three hours.

What the Medical Community Has to Say

When it comes to what the medical community has to say about this diet, most of the things they have to say are not really complimentary to the diet. You see, most people in the medical field really feel like much of what the author says in the books is not true and that there is not scientific premise for it, such as the idea that drinking water with your meal is bad. So, for the most part, this is not a diet that has impressed the medical field in any manner.

7. Take Self-Portraits Because the iPhone camera shutter’s button is a “soft” (i.e., onscreen) button, it’s a bit tricky to take self-portraits with it since you have to turn the phone around so you can no longer see the button. Here’s the solution: with the camera feature selected, place your finger on the camera icon and turn the phone around so you’re facing the lens. Then, smile pretty and let go of the shutter button! You’ll hear the telltale “click” — and, you’ve just taken a self-portrait!

8. Reveal Secret Features: When Apple released the first firmware update for the iPhone on August 1, 2007, it did so with little fanfare, and attributed most of the updates to “security fixes.” The Wall Street Journal’s Walt Mossberg discovered a few new non-security-related features on his side phone after the update including:

- Greater capacity in the iPhone module’s Favorites list (used to be 20, is now 50).
– Ability to automatically blind carbon copy (BCC) yourself on all e-mails sent, where previously, your only option was to CC yourself, which alerted your recipients what you were up to…
– Compatibility with some car adapters and external speakers, originally created for the iPod. For more iPhone and tech tidbits, visit Walt’s blog.

RAISE A BILINGUAL CHILD

Many fathers want their kids to learn English and learn Mandarin, but what is the best to develop bilingualism in young ones?

 

TEACH BOTH LANGUAGES SIMULTANEOUSLY. A kid has the inborn capability to learn English and learn Chinese. As such, children under three or four need not be able to distinguish which sentence is English and which is Mandarin. To naturally help kid to build up the language logics, we need to teach them to express themselves in correct, fluent sentences in a conducive environment which will lead to successful bilingualism. Flashcards is also good tool to help children acquire the languages.

 

AVOID MIXING THE TWO LANGUAGES. When talking with young ones , consistently use language that is correct and standardized. To main the purity of each language, we should not mix both languages in a single sentence.

 

BUILD A CONDUCIVE HOME ENVIRONMENT. The most ideal home environment for bilingualism is to have someone communicating with the child wholly in English, and someone talking with the kid wholly in Mandarin.

 

CHOOSE THE RIGHT SCHOOL. Some families lack the environment for bilingualism. Thus, selecting a good bilingual school for the child will be important. When learning a language, a kid requires more than one or two hours of lessons in class – the language environment in their daily lives also plays a big role. In class, young ones learn through nursery rhymes, songs and storybooks. Although most young ones are able to read and speak Chinese, they are unable to communicate with others and express themselves appropriately in their daily lives. Therefore, when it comes to bilingual schools, fathers should evaluate the classroom lessons as well as the bilingual environment.

LOOK FOR ENRICHMENT CLASSES IN CHINESE. For a kid to master bilingualism, Mandarin lessons alone may not achieve the best results. To balance children’s exposure to the two languages, parents can look for calligraphy, dance and music classes that are taught in Mandarin.

Tips How To Plant Roses

Our town, is in an area heavily forested with pine trees, but my two lots and others to the north and south are what would be called a clearing in most forests. The reason, the soil too thin over an impervious underlayer for trees to grow, save one and it is the problem in my story.

I have always been an enthusiastic gardener but I shied away from roses. They were more trouble than their worth, pruning, spraying, etc. After moving to Oregon I acquired by purchase a house, two lots and a few scraggly rose bushes. All I knew to do for them was to give them water (not enough though I later learned).

After a long period of neglect they responded so slowly that I said in disgust, I am going to dig them up and plant a lawn. Next spring came and they suddenly took off and I found myself a rose grower.

Not many of the original planting remain. I learned by trial and error which would and would not grow (for me, let us say). White and most of the red varieties are best left alone.

I have purchased, planted, dug up and thrown away so many that I am immune to the blandishments of the rose catalogs; A few varieties are the exception. The pink and yellow roses do well.

I do not use a mulch. While the rest of the country is having 100% heat, here the summer fog ghosts through the trees leaving mildew, rust and other ills in its wake.

Last summer I was almost licked. After giving them their weekly spraying with my supposedly all-purpose spray as well as some liquid fertilizer, I viewed the results with a jaundiced eye and on impulse picked up some sulfur and dusted them. From then on things were better.

All my beds have to be raised for reasons mentioned earlier. We will now go back to that pine tree; because it stands alone it not only grew tall but wide. Being to the south it casts a shadow which blankets my yard from September to March.

Through the years I have learned just where the sunshine will be and for how long. That is where the roses are planted, seemingly without rhyme or reason. I have about 50 plants and would have room for a few more, if I could persuade my neighbor to prune that pine tree.

That I have achieved a measure of success may be illustrated by this incident which gave me much pleasure. Some out of town friends were trying to find our place for the first time, they asked a man, unknown, where Lobos St. was. The reply, that is the street the roses are on and proceeded to direct them.

I read the news of others not so fortunate to enjoy roses and the landscape and consider myself fortunate indeed. As usual, my roses lead the pack. It is my favorite group of plants because they bloom in bursts all summer, ending with a final burst in October.

I root feed only once and then foliar feed as I spray (once a week including a foliar feeding every two weeks). I do not know why I felt impelled to share this unless it gave me an excuse to put on paper the great enjoyment I get in the growing of roses.
